If you want to write for American filmmakers, you need to learn fluent English. Period. If you spent half as much time focusing on that (using one of many online language learning systems) as you do posting about Speilberg or asking if anyone would "rate" your disorganized ramblings, you'd be there already.

Then, learn to write a screenlplay in proper format.

Once you've done those two things, you're gonna end up writing several scripts before you see even modest results from one.

Don't waste your money trying to move to the States. If you start to find success AFTER you've been writing completed, fluent screenplays, and it makes career sense, then do it. But that's a long way off. You're gonna need to maintain income from a separate job to keep you afloat whie you do all this. That's just the way it goes.
